
New York, NY (APRIL 24, 2026) – Lukas Graham’s new single “To Know A Girl” is out today via Virgin Music Group, marking a return to the folk-driven storytelling and acoustic instrumentation that shaped his earliest musical identity, informed by the Irish musical traditions that influenced his upbringing.
Emerging from Christiania—the free-spirited Copenhagen community where he grew up—Lukas was surrounded by touring folk musicians who passed through his family home, bringing with them the Irish musical traditions his father loved. “To Know A Girl” channels that atmosphere directly, offering a sense of coming home and reconnecting with something essential. The track also serves as an early glimpse of his forthcoming album arriving this summer, reflecting a renewed focus on the narrative style and musical roots that continue to define his work.
“The sound of the song reminds me of coming all the way back home, reconnecting with the songwriting tradition and the instruments that formed the soundtrack of my childhood.” — Lukas Graham
That roots-music spirit adds new texture to the raw emotional honesty that has defined Lukas Graham’s career. The GRAMMY-nominated Danish soul-pop artist first achieved global fame with the 2015 breakout hit “7 Years” — a reflective ballad that earned three GRAMMY nominations, topped charts in more than 15 countries, and placed him among the first 25 artists in Spotify’s Billions Club. Over the past decade, he has built a multi-platinum international career spanning four albums, with hits including “Love Someone,” certified platinum in 18 countries. His work blends soul, pop, and deeply personal storytelling, exploring themes of family, love, and resilience — from the loss of his father to becoming one himself.
Known for his emotional depth and powerful live presence, Lukas Graham has sold out tours across Europe, North America, and Asia, and performed on major stages including the GRAMMY Awards, MTV VMAs, and Good Morning America. This year, he will join Ed Sheeran as a special guest on select North American dates of the 2026 “Loop Tour,” beginning August 15 at U.S. Bank Stadium in Minneapolis, MN — for a full list of dates, see below.
